Bathtub replacement services involve removing an existing bathtub and installing a new one in its place. This process typically includes carefully removing the old fixture, preparing the space for the new bathtub, and ensuring proper sealing and fitting to prevent leaks. Professional service providers can handle a variety of bathtub styles and sizes, making it possible to update the look of a bathroom or replace a damaged or outdated tub with a modern, functional option.

This service helps address a range of common problems homeowners face with their existing bathtubs. Cracks, chips, or significant wear can compromise the appearance and safety of a bathroom. Older tubs may also develop issues such as staining, mold, or difficulty in cleaning. Additionally, a bathtub that no longer fits the needs of the household-such as a small or awkwardly shaped tub-can be replaced to improve comfort and usability.

The overview below groups typical Bathtub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or bathtub replacements or rep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ve straightforward upgrades or repairs that local contractors can complete efficiently. Larger or more complex repairs may fall outside this range and cost more.

Standard Replacement - replacing an existing bathtub with a similar model gener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Many common installations fall within this band, with costs varying based on the tub type and installation specifics.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range.

Luxury or Custom Installations - high-end or custom bathtub replacements can range from $3,500 to $8,000 or more. These projects often involve premium materials, specialized features, or complex configurations that local service providers can handle. Such projects are less common but available for those seeking upscale options.

Full Bathroom Renovation - when replacing a bathtub as part of a complete bathroom remodel, costs can start around $10,000 and go significantly higher depending on scope. Many full renovations fall into this range, with larger projects reaching into the $20,000+ territory for extensive upgrades and custom features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for bathtub repl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of successfully completing bathtub replacements or related bathroom renovation tasks. An experienced professional will be familiar with common challenges and best practices, which can contribute to a smoother process and a quality result. Asking for information about past work or examples of completed projects can help gauge a contractor’s familiarity with the scope and details of bathtub replacement jobs.

Clear, written expectations are essential to ensure both parties are aligned about the scope of work, materials, and any specific requirements. Homeowners should seek out service providers who are willing to provide detailed estimates or proposals that outline the work involved, the materials to be used, and any other relevant details.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It’s also beneficial to clarify what the process will entail and what the homeowner can expect during each phase of the work.

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a reliable local contractor. Homeowners should inquire about references from previous clients who had similar projects completed. Speaking with past customers can provide insights into the contractor’s professionalism, reliability, and quality of work. Additionally, choosing a service provider who maintains open and clear communication can make the process more straightforward and less stressful. A contractor who responds promptly and provides transparent information demonstrates a commitment to customer service, which is valuable when managing expectations and addressing questions or concerns during the project.
